Introduction

A seal is a device or component that is used to fill the gap between two mating surfaces. It isolates the system from an external environment; thus, preventing leakage from them. Chemical transportation seals are used in tank trucks, rail tankers, and ISO tankers to prevent the media from leakage and contamination. They are generally used in manlids, foot valves, ball valves, butterfly valves, airline valves, pressure-vacuum valves, pumps, and flanges of a chemical tanker.

Seals used in the chemical transportation industry are majorly made from either pol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) perfluoro elastomer (FFKM) or ethylene propylene diene monomer (EPDM). These materials provide exceptional durability, excellent wear resistance, and outstanding chemical resistance against a wide range of chemicals. These seals are mainly used in the form of o-rings and gaskets in tankers to prevent any non-accidental releases (NARs) during the time of chemical transportation. Stringent regulations to prevent non-accidental releases of chemicals during transportation are a factor assuring a healthy demand for seals in chemical transportation.

Market Drivers

Organic growth of the chemical industry, increasing chemical export and imports across the world, and increasing chemical tanker fleet are some of the major factors driving the growth of the chemical transportation seal’s market. Rapidly expanding the industrial sector in emerging economies is providing new revenue avenues for the market participants in the chemical transportation seal market.

By Application Type

“The valves segment dominates the market during the forecast period.”

The chemical transportation seals market is segmented into manlids, valves, and others. The valves segment is likely to remain dominant in the market during the forecast period, as a large number of valves, such as foot valves, ball valves, butterfly valves, airline valves, and pressure vacuum valves; are used in a chemical tanker.

By Material Type

“PTFE segment dominates the market during the forecast period.”

The market is segmented into PTFE, FFKM, EPDM, and others. PTFE is expected to remain the dominant and fastest-growing segment during the forecast period. PTFE seals are predominantly used in chemical tankers owing to their excellent properties, including high flexibility, excellent chemical resistance to a wide array of chemicals, high thermal resistance, and high flexural strength.

By Product Type

“O-rings dominate the market during the forecast period.”

The chemical transportation seals market is segmented into o-rings, gaskets, and others. O-rings are expected to remain dominant and the fastest-growing material type during the forecast period. They can operate at a wide range of temperature and pressure and are used in diverse applications, including ball valves, butterfly valves, pressure vacuum valves, and airline valves.

Regional Analysis

“Europe is projected to remain the largest market for chemical transportation seals during the forecast period.”

Increasing chemical exports by major countries of the region, such as Germany, France, the United Kingdom, Belgium, the Netherlands, and Ireland, are driving the demand for chemical tankers in the region, which, in turn, is driving the demand for chemical transportation seals. Germany and France are also the two largest chemical producers in the region, followed by Italy and the Netherlands. All these factors are contributing to the dominance of the region in the chemical transportation seal market.

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ing market for chemical transportation seals during the forecast period. The region’s demand for the chemical transportation seals is majorly driven by the Japanese shipyards, which has maintained a steady share in the chemical tankers market; and China, which is the largest consumer of organic chemicals. The increased seaborne trade of methanol has also positively impacted the growth of Asia-Pacific’s chemical transportation seal market.
